I’m in a couple of leagues where there are seemingly perpetual bottom dwellers that don’t seem to ever try to really rebuild. Aging productive vets just seem to die on their rosters
When contending, I will make offers several times a year to send picks and/or youth for their veterans and they just always reject them with no counters and go on finishing in the bottom half year and year. I really don’t get it and maybe I should just be happy there are owners like this that are no competition and move on. But I am curious if anybody has any advice on getting some of these owners to more actively try to rebuild and sell their veterans

I'm in four dynasties and one redraft. Of those, I know the guys in three, we go back some 10-15 years. Any time I try to trade with anyone I try to remember who they are and what they are like when it comes to trades. There are some guys that just ignore my offers no matter what, or only if they really win big. There are some guys that are homers—one guy loves DAL, so I can usually make a good trade if I can pony up a DAL player. Another guy is so random—he'll make a horrible offer, and then take a different offer I make that really benefits me. I get to know each guy and then try to meet them where they are. I often have longer conversations via email, where I try to understand what they want—are they trying to get younger, are they moving depth for an upgrade, are they looking for only picks, etc.
In one of my new leagues, I don't know them well, so what I'm finding out is—one guys loves rookies, one guys only uses KTC to evaluate trades and values, one guy hates ALL calculators and it's all about his gut. So, I'm learning what works with each guy.

There are many owners who do not enjoy the back-and-forth of multi-stage negotiations. With these type owners, you have to make your best offer first ... or at least an offer that is not lower than fair market value.
You must meet your trading partners at the level at which they are willing to engage. For many, lowball offers are auto-rejects with no counter and no communication.

I've bought many used cars in my life. I've bought several properties. Never have I gotten into a back-and-forth negotiation about the price. I'll see an advertised price I like, make an offer, and whatever the seller says next is pretty much it. Either the price is too much and I walk without negotiating, or it's in my range and I buy. Period. When someone wants to negotiate back and forth six times, that's a game I'm not interested in playing, in real life and in fantasy sports. That's great for those who enjoy it, but it's not for me.
If someone makes an offer to me, make it real. Too low and I'll simply reject without a counter.

Back directly to what the OP asked.
Bulletproof, if you really want to trade with a guy and he rejected your first offer without a counter, you can keep going. Did you make a fair market value first offer or was it a low offer? If it was low, make a second offer, significantly better.
I've made two or three offers before, when the other guy rejected without a counter. Some managers just don't communicate or counter, but if you make better and better offers, you might get to what he really wants ... even if he never counters.
A word of warning: Don't make tiny incremental increases. No one want to reject an offer, then receive a counter of the original offer plus a 4th. If you're going to make second offer, rise up to your top price or extremely close to it. Put it on the table. Otherwise, you're just wasting both your time and his.
